Ressource: PickingSession
Darstellung einer Nutzersitzung, in der der Nutzer Fotos und Videos mit Google Fotos auswählen kann.
JSON-Darstellung |
---|
{
"id": string,
"pickerUri": string,
"pollingConfig": {
object ( |
Felder | |
---|---|
id |
Nur Ausgabe. Die von Google generierte Kennung für diese Sitzung. |
pickerUri |
Nur Ausgabe. Der URI, über den der Nutzer zu Google Fotos (im Web) weitergeleitet wird, damit er Fotos und Videos für die aktuelle Sitzung auswählen kann. Damit diese Seite angezeigt werden kann, muss der Nutzer in seinem Webbrowser in dem Google-Konto angemeldet sein, zu dem diese Sitzung gehört. Die |
pollingConfig |
Nur Ausgabe. Die empfohlene Konfiguration, die Anwendungen beim Abfragen von Dieses Feld wird nur ausgefüllt, wenn für diese Sitzung noch keine Medienelemente ausgewählt wurden (d.h. |
expireTime |
Nur Ausgabe. Zeitpunkt, zu dem der Zugriff auf diese Sitzung (und die ausgewählten Medienelemente) abläuft. Ein Zeitstempel im Format RFC3339 UTC "Zulu" mit einer Auflösung im Nanosekundenbereich und bis zu neun Nachkommastellen. Beispiele: |
mediaItemsSet |
Nur Ausgabe. Wenn |
PollingConfig
Konfiguration für das Abfragen der API.
JSON-Darstellung |
---|
{ "pollInterval": string, "timeoutIn": string } |
Felder | |
---|---|
pollInterval |
Nur Ausgabe. Empfohlene Zeit zwischen Abfrageanfragen. Die Dauer in Sekunden mit bis zu neun Nachkommastellen und am Ende mit " |
timeoutIn |
Nur Ausgabe. Die Zeitspanne, nach der der Client das Polling beenden soll. Ein Wert von 0 gibt an, dass der Client die Abfrage beenden soll, falls er dies noch nicht getan hat. Die Dauer in Sekunden mit bis zu neun Nachkommastellen und am Ende mit " |
Methoden |
|
---|---|
|
Erzeugt eine neue Sitzung, in der der Nutzer Fotos und Videos für den Zugriff von Drittanbietern auswählen kann. |
|
Löscht die angegebene Sitzung. |
|
Ruft Informationen zur angegebenen Sitzung ab. |